Newsflash - Ukrainian Free Trade Arrangement

As announced on 25 April, the UK has legislated to implement the Ukrainian Free Trade Arrangement from 6pm Tuesday 10 May.

This reduces tariffs on goods of Ukrainian origin to zero. Further information can be found in the announcement here: UK announces new trade measures to support Ukraine,

and The Customs Tariff (Preferential Trade Arrangements and Tariff Quotas) (Ukraine) (Amendment) Regulations 2022
